The Mountain's Enigma: A Whispers of Gold Mystery
In the heart of a rugged, mist-enshrouded mountain range, legends whispered of a treasure hidden within its craggy depths. The tale was as old as the mountains themselves, a tale of a nobleman who, in a fit of jealousy, buried his wife's most precious possession—a golden amulet said to possess the power of the earth itself. The nobleman, driven by his greed and despair, sealed the amulet within the mountain's core, vowing to reclaim it one day.
Centuries passed, and the legend grew into a myth. It was said that the treasure could only be found by one who was pure of heart and true in spirit. Many had tried, but none had succeeded. Until one fateful day, when a young detective named Elara stepped into the mountains' embrace.
Elara had a reputation for her sharp mind and relentless pursuit of the truth. Her latest case, a seemingly simple theft, had led her to this remote mountain village, where the legend of the treasure was whispered like a haunting melody. The villagers spoke of the mountain's enigma with a mix of reverence and fear, and Elara knew that the answer to the theft lay hidden within the depths of the mountain's enigma.
As she ventured into the mountains, Elara was accompanied by a local guide, an old man named Gaius, who had grown up hearing the tales of the treasure. Gaius was a man of few words, but his eyes held a wisdom that spoke of countless nights spent gazing at the stars and listening to the mountain's secrets.
The journey was arduous, with the path winding through dense forests and over treacherous terrain. Elara and Gaius encountered many challenges, from treacherous ravines to sudden storms that threatened to turn their quest into a desperate struggle for survival. But it was not the physical dangers that tested Elara's resolve, but the emotional ones.
As they delved deeper into the mountain, Elara found herself confronting her own fears and insecurities. She remembered the pain of losing her parents in a car accident, a loss that had left her feeling abandoned and alone. The mountain's enigma seemed to mirror her own inner turmoil, challenging her to confront the shadows of her past.
One evening, as they camped by a rushing river, Elara confided in Gaius about her fears. "I can't help but feel like this treasure is more than just gold," she said, her voice barely above a whisper. "It's a symbol of something lost, something I can never have again."
Gaius nodded, his eyes reflecting the firelight. "The mountain has a way of revealing what lies within our hearts," he replied. "It doesn't matter if the treasure is gold or a memory. What matters is the journey and what we learn along the way."
As the days turned into weeks, Elara and Gaius faced trials that pushed them to their limits. They deciphered ancient runes, navigated through cavernous tunnels, and outsmarted traps that had been laid centuries ago. Each challenge brought them closer to the heart of the mountain, and each victory was a step towards understanding the true nature of the treasure.
Finally, they reached the chamber where the amulet was said to be hidden. The air was thick with anticipation as Elara approached the pedestal, her heart pounding with a mix of fear and hope. She reached out to touch the amulet, and as her fingers brushed against the cool metal, she felt a surge of energy course through her veins.
Suddenly, the chamber began to tremble, and the walls around her seemed to come alive with whispers of the past. She saw visions of the nobleman and his wife, a love story that had been lost to time. She saw the moment of betrayal, the pain and sorrow that had driven the nobleman to his greed.
As the visions faded, Elara realized that the treasure was not gold, but the memory of a love that had withstood the test of time. The amulet was a symbol of that love, a reminder that true treasure lies in the bonds we form and the memories we create.
With a heavy heart, Elara placed the amulet back on the pedestal and turned to leave. Gaius, who had been watching her with a knowing smile, nodded in approval. "You have found the true treasure," he said. "It lies within you."
Elara looked at Gaius, understanding his words. She had faced her fears, confronted her past, and found the strength to move forward. The Mountain's Enigma had not been a quest for gold, but a journey of self-discovery and redemption.
As they made their way back to the village, Elara felt a sense of peace and fulfillment. She knew that the legend of the Mountain's Enigma would continue to be whispered for generations, but she also knew that she had uncovered a truth that was far more valuable than any treasure could ever be.
